GREENDALE, WI — A 22-year-old was arrested after authorities say he drove drunk and crashed into a wooded area in Greendale.

According to Greendale police call logs, an officer on patrol spotted a vehicle traveling at a high rate of speed just before 2 a.m. on Aug. 29 on W. Edgerton Ave. from S. 76th Street.

Police said the officer lost sight of the vehicle, but found it after it crashed into a wooded area on S. 78th Street at W. Abbott Ave.

Police said the driver, a 22-year-old Greendale man, was arrested on suspicion of his first drunken-driving offense after the officer conducted field sobriety tests.

Greendale police said N&S Towing pulled the vehicle from the wooded area. The man was booked at the Greendale police department and later released.
